Genuine Kubota Tractor OEM Parts

ROD,SHIFT

3N330-29910

Kubota Tractor

ROD,SHIFT

3N330-29910

Kubota Tractor

ROD,SHIFT

3N330-29910

 

Not Available
For Earth, For Life